Process




  1. Go to a website that provides MPC Toolbar Images, such as this one

  2. Download the toolbar/image. If it's zipped, extract it.

  3. Move the image file to the base installation folder (where the .exe is).


Explanation



Media Player Classic (MPC) themes are stored as a single .png, .bmp or .svg, which is loaded from the MPC installation base folder.



MPC is usually installed somewhere similar to either:





  • C:Program FilesMPC-HC or


  • C:Program FilesCombined Community Codec PackMPC (if it was bundled with CCCP).
